Article Engineering, Electrical & Electronic

Identification of Composite Insulator Criticality Based on a New Leakage Current Diagnostic Index

Mousalreza Faramarzi Palangar et al.

Summary: The article proposes a new method to identify the health condition of composite insulators through analyzing the leakage current (LC), electric potential (EP), and electric field stress (EFS). The analysis shows a strong correlation between LC harmonics and insulator health status, introducing a new diagnostic index to quantify the insulator criticality and predict flashover occurrence. This analysis method can enhance network reliability by avoiding insulator failures and implementing proper condition-based maintenance.
